实用CICD工具推荐:提升开发效率的秘诀

1.极狐GitLab是一款功能全面的CICD工具 2.自动化流程显著提高开发效 3.优化协作与代码管理 4.灵活集成提高工作流程的效率。极狐GitLab不仅提供了全面的代码管理功能,还通过自动化流水线减少了人工干预,提高了代码交付的速度和质量。其内置的CI/CD功能使得开发团队能够快速构建、测试和部署应用程序。此外,极狐GitLab支持多种编程语言和平台,能够与其他工具无缝集成,极大地提高了团队的协作效率和项目管理水平。通过使用极狐GitLab,开发团队可以更加专注于核心代码的开发与创新。

一、极狐GITLAB:功能全面的CICD工具

fa487b0c71620d7b74e1c2b22ac0db75.jpeg

极狐GitLab是一款集成了版本控制、CI/CD、项目管理等多功能于一体的开发平台。其内置的CI/CD功能使得开发者能够自动化构建、测试和部署流程,从而大幅提升开发效率。极狐GitLab的优势在于它的集成性,无需借助第三方工具,开发团队即可在同一平台上完成从代码提交到应用部署的全过程。极狐GitLab的界面友好,易于上手,支持多种编程语言,使得跨团队协作和代码管理变得更加高效。通过极狐GitLab,开发者可以轻松实现代码版本控制、持续集成和持续交付,确保代码质量和部署速度的提升。

极狐GitLab官网:GitLab-10万企业使用的一站式DevOps平台_GitLab中文官网

二、GITLAB:广泛应用的开源平台

GitLab作为一个开源平台,为开发者提供了一整套的开发工具,支持从代码管理到CI/CD的完整流程。GitLab的开源特性使得它具有高度的可定制性,开发团队可以根据自身需求进行功能扩展和二次开发。GitLab的CI/CD功能同样强大,支持自动化构建和测试,帮助开发者快速识别和解决代码中的问题。GitLab与极狐GitLab的不同在于其社区版的开放性,用户可以根据项目需求灵活选择不同的版本和功能。GitLab在全球范围内被广泛应用于各类软件开发项目,其稳定性和安全性得到了众多开发者的认可。

三、JENKINS:灵活可扩展的自动化服务器

Jenkins是另一个备受欢迎的开源自动化服务器,广泛用于CI/CD流程。它提供了丰富的插件生态系统,使得用户可以根据需要进行功能扩展。Jenkins的灵活性和可扩展性使其成为很多企业实施CI/CD流程的首选工具。Jenkins的优势在于其强大的社区支持,用户可以通过插件实现几乎所有的自动化需求。然而,Jenkins的配置和维护相对复杂,需要一定的技术背景和经验来确保其稳定运行。对于需要高度定制化CI/CD流程的企业,Jenkins是一个理想的选择。

四、CIRCLECI:云端优先的CICD解决方案

CircleCI是一款云端优先的CI/CD工具,支持快速配置和部署,适合现代化的云原生应用开发。其基于云的架构使得开发团队无需维护复杂的基础设施,能够专注于代码本身。CircleCI的优势在于其快速的部署和更新能力,支持多种编程语言和框架,能够与主流的代码仓库无缝集成。对于注重快速迭代和持续交付的开发团队,CircleCI提供了一个高效的解决方案。其基于订阅的服务模式也使得成本控制更加灵活,适合不同规模的企业使用。

五、TRAVIS CI:开源项目的理想选择

Travis CI是一款针对开源项目优化的CI/CD工具,广泛应用于GitHub上的开源项目。它提供了简单易用的配置方式,用户只需在项目中添加一个配置文件即可启用自动化构建和测试。Travis CI的优势在于其对开源项目的免费支持,为众多开源开发者提供了持续集成和交付的基础设施。对于中小型项目和个人开发者,Travis CI是一个低门槛、高效率的选择。其与GitHub的紧密集成也使得代码管理和协作变得更加便捷。

六、BAMBOO:企业级的CICD平台

Bamboo是Atlassian公司推出的企业级CI/CD工具,与Jira、Bitbucket等工具无缝集成。Bamboo专注于提供稳定和可靠的CI/CD流程,适合大型企业和复杂项目的需求。Bamboo的优势在于其企业级的支持和服务,能够满足企业在安全性、合规性和性能上的高标准要求。对于需要高度集成和定制化的企业,Bamboo提供了强大的功能和灵活的配置选项。其与Atlassian生态系统的深度集成也使得项目管理和开发流程更加流畅和高效。

通过选择合适的CICD工具,开发团队可以显著提升工作效率和代码质量。无论是极狐GitLab、GitLab,还是其他工具,关键在于根据项目需求和团队规模进行合理选择。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值